タグ付けされた質問 「copy」

モノを複製して2つの類似したものを作成する。

9
Linuxでファイルを保存するディレクトリパスをコピーする方法は?
Eclipseプロジェクトとその中に ".project"ファイルがあり、ディレクトリ構造は ' myProject/.project'のように見えます。これらの「.project」ファイルを別のディレクトリにコピーしたいのですが、囲んでいるディレクトリ名を保持したいです。 「a/myProject/.project」があり、「myProject/.project」を「b」にコピーしたいので、「」になりますb/myProject/.projectが、「b/myProject」は存在しません。私が試してみると: cp -r ./myProject/.project ../b 「myproject」ディレクトリなしで、「。project」ファイル自体のみをコピーします。お知らせ下さい。
88 linux  directory  copy 

5
ソースファイルが存在しないときに「cp」コマンドでエラーが発生しないようにするにはどうすればよいですか?
私はMac OS Xを使用しています。このようなビルドスクリプトのcpコマンドでいくつかのファイルをコピーしようとしています。 cp ./src/*/*.h ./aaa ただし、。/ srcディレクトリに.hファイルがない場合、このコマンドはエラーを発生させます。コマンドがエラーを発生させないようにする方法は?(サイレント障害)エラーによりビルド結果が失敗しますが、ヘッダーファイルがある場合にのみコピーしたいです。
59 shell  copy 

8
Rsync:タイムスタンプのみをコピー
現在、タイムスタンプを除き、すべての点で同一の2つのディレクトリA /とB /があります。したがって、コマンドを実行すると: rsync --dry-run -crvv A/ B/ コマンドは次のようになりますが、すべてのファイルは「最新」とマークされます。 rsync --dry-run -rvv A/ B/ すべてのファイルがA /からB /にコピーされることを示しています。 私の質問はこれです:ファイルが(内容に関して)同一であることを知っていれば、B /内のファイルのタイムスタンプをファイル内のタイムスタンプと同じになるように(rsyncまたは他の方法で)設定する方法がありますA /、A /からB /にすべてのファイルをコピーせずに? ありがとう

7
ファイルをコピーするWindowsコマンドラインコマンドとは何ですか?
ファイルをコピーするWindowsコマンドプロンプトコマンドとは何ですか? ファイルをロケーションAからロケーションBに移動する必要があります。また、ロケーションBのフォルダーが存在しない場合は作成します。 これを自動化できるように、コマンドラインにする必要があります。 WindowsのバージョンはXPです。

5
日付より古い別のディレクトリにファイルを移動する
今日から1年前のファイルを移動するソリューションを探しています。ログパーティションがいっぱいになりましたが、削除できません。それらは長い間必要です。とにかく私が思いついた1つの解決策は次のとおりです。 find /sourcedirectory -mtime 365 -exec mv "{}" /destination/directory/ \; これは機能しますか?「-mtime 365」のために尋ねると、今日から1年前のファイルが新しい場所に移動されますか? ありがとうございました!
28 unix  files  find  copy 

7
Linux / Unixの同一ツリーへのアクセス許可のコピー
正しい権限を持つファイルのツリーがあります。その後、私は間違ったアクセス許可を持つ(ファイルごとに)同一のツリー(異なるファイルコンテンツを持つ)を持っています。 あるツリーから別のツリーにアクセス許可のレイアウトを転送するにはどうすればよいですか?

3
安全でないネットワークを介してサーバー間で安全なrsyncを実行する方法
基本的に私が求めているのは、誰かがsshの中にrsyncをラップする手段に出くわしたことです。 OpenSSH v4.9 +では、sftpには着信接続などをchrootできるいくつかの素晴らしいオプションがあります-それは私が見ているソリューションですが、RHELに固執していますが、RHEL4もRHEL5もそのバージョンまではありませんssh。 私の現在の解決策は、クライアントユーザーのキーを使用してこのようなものをサーバー側に追加することです... server%cat〜/ .ssh / authorized_keys command = "cd / srv / rsync / etl && tar --exclude './lost+found' -pcf-./" ssh-rsa ... ...したがって、クライアントは1つのことと1つのことだけに制限されます... client%ssh -T -i $ {HOME} /。ssh / id_rsa oracle@database.com> sensative.tar これにより、接続とサーバー(クライアントから)が保護されますが、すべてのファイルが何度も取得されるため、非効率的です。 私はrsyncを使用して同様の(またはちょうど良い)ことをした後です。
19 rsync  ssh  copy  tar  security 

6
隠しファイルを再帰的にコピーする-Linux
ディレクトリ内のすべての隠しファイルを別のディレクトリに再帰的にコピーする簡単な方法はありますか?通常のファイルではなく、すべての設定ファイルをホームディレクトリにバックアップしたいと思います。私は試した: cp -R .* directory しかし、すべての隠されていないファイルも認識.し..、再帰的にコピーします。cpに.and を無視させる方法はあり..ますか?
19 linux  copy  files  cp 

2
cp(コピー)コマンドのインタラクティブモードをオフにする(cp:overwrite?)
cpを使用するときにインタラクティブモードをオフにする方法を知っていますか? ディレクトリを別のディレクトリに再帰的にコピーしようとしていますが、上書きされるファイルごとに「y」と答える必要があります。 私が使用しているコマンドは次のとおりです。 cp -r /usr/share/drupal-update/* /usr/share/drupal しかし、私はそれぞれの上書きを確認するよう求められます: cp: overwrite `./CHANGELOG.txt'? y cp: overwrite `./COPYRIGHT.txt'? y cp: overwrite `./INSTALL.mysql.txt'? y cp: overwrite `./INSTALL.pgsql.txt'? y ... 私はubuntuサーバーのバージョンを使用しています。 ありがとう!
17 linux  ubuntu  copy  ubuntu-9.04  cp 

8
Linuxのファイルではなくディレクトリツリーをコピーするにはどうすればよいですか?
ある場所から別の場所に約200個のディレクトリとサブディレクトリをコピーしたいのですが、それらのディレクトリ内の何千ものファイルをコピーしたくありません。私はLinuxを使用しています。 注:すべてをコピーしてからすべてのファイルを削除するのに十分なスペースがありません。

7
Ansibleで複数のファイルをリモートマシンからローカルに取得する方法
Ansibleを使用してリモートディレクトリからローカルディレクトリにファイルをコピーしたいのですが、フェッチモジュールでは1つのファイルしかコピーできません。ファイルが必要なサーバーが多数あり(各サーバーで同じディレクトリ)、Ansibleでこれを行う方法は今はありません。 何か案は?
17 linux  copy  ansible 

4
cpコマンドは、-fを使用しても上書き時にプロンプ​​トを表示します
次のコマンドを使用して、1つのフォルダから別のフォルダにすべての新しいjpgをコピーしようとしています cp -u --force /home/oldfolder/*.jpg /home/newfolder/ そして、私は次のプロンプトを受け取ります: cp: overwrite `/home/newfolder/4095-181.jpg'? 私が知っている「-u」は、新しいファイルでプロンプトを表示するだけで正常に動作していますが、プロンプトを取得したくないので、上書きするだけです。--forceと-fを試しました 助言がありますか? 前もって感謝します
16 centos  bash  copy 

7
存在しない場合にファイルをcpしてディレクトリを作成する方法は?
ディレクトリ構造を維持しながら、svnリポジトリ内の変更されたファイルを別のディレクトリにコピーしたいと思います。 awkとxargsのマンページを読んだ後、次のようにファイル名を変更する方法を見つけました。 $ svn status -q | awk '{ print $2 }' | xargs -d \\n -I '{}' cp '{}' /tmp/xen/ しかし問題は、この方法ではディレクトリ構造が保持されないため、次のようにファイルをコピーすることです。 ./common/superp.c -> /tmp/xen/common/superp.c ./common/m2mgr.c -> /tmp/xen/common/m2mgr.c ./common/page_alloc.c -> /tmp/xen/common/page_alloc.c ./arch/x86/mm.c -> /tmp/xen/arch/x86/mm.c ./arch/x86/mm/shadow/private.h -> /tmp/xen/arch/x86/mm/shadow/private.h cpコマンドをcp '{}' / tmp / xen / '{}'に変更しようとしましたが、そのようなファイルやディレクトリはありませんでした。cpコピーファイルを作成し、必要に応じてディレクトリを作成する方法はありますか?そして、このコマンドチェーンを単純化できるかどうかを指摘してください。:-) 返信ありがとうございます。ディレクトリが少し大きいので、cp -Rまたはrsyncを使用してディレクトリ全体をコピーしたくありません。タールパイプを使用するというCKの提案は非常に便利です。 svn status -q …

6
プログレスバーがあるUnixコピーコマンドですが、rsyncほど重くはありません
たくさんのファイルをコピーする必要があります。通常、rsyncを使用するのは、-aPオプションを渡すと、(a)処理するファイルの数と(b)個々のファイルがどれだけコピーされるかがわかるからです。 ただし、rsyncは、ファイルがコピーされたことを確認するためにチェックサムを使用して多くのことを行います。しかし、私は今それを本当に必要としません。ただし、通常cpのファイルには、上記の残りのファイル数は含まれていません。これは非常に役立ちます。 cp残っているファイルの数の進行状況を含むようなものはありますが、それほど重いものではありませんrsyncか?
14 rsync  copy  cp 


弊社のサイトを使用することにより、あなたは弊社のクッキーポリシーおよびプライバシーポリシーを読み、理解したものとみなされます。
Licensed under cc by-sa 3.0 with attribution required.